Durham to Newcastle by train

A train trip from Durham to Newcastle takes about 15 mins on average, covering roughly 13 miles (21 kilometres). With around 65 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£2.00,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Durham to Newcastle start from as little as £2.00

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Durham to Newcastle start from £4.30 one way, or £8.60 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Durham to Newcastle are available for £5.00 one way, or £10.00 return

Station Amenities and Facilities

Durham train station is well-equipped with a range of facilities to ensure a comfortable journey for all travelers. The ticket office is open from 06:00 to 18:00 on weekdays, 07:00 to 17:00 on Saturdays, and 09:00 to 16:00 on Sundays. For those preferring the convenience of self-service, ticket machines are available with accessible options. Smartcards can also be issued and validated at this station.

Help and support facilities include customer information points, departure and arrival screens, and an induction loop system. Staff assistance is available on Sundays from 07:00 to 23:59, ensuring help is at hand for those who need it. CCTV coverage adds an extra layer of security for all passengers.

The station promotes accessibility with step-free access to all platforms, accessible ticket machines, and heated waiting rooms designed to provide a comfortable experience for everyone. Additionally, baby changing facilities and RADAR key accessible toilets are available on both platforms, highlighting the station's commitment to inclusivity.

Onward Travel and Connections

Durham train station serves as a gateway to a plethora of onward travel options. For those in need of a taxi, there is a taxi rank available, making trips into the city or beyond seamless. Although advance taxi bookings are unnecessary, if you prefer to plan ahead, you can call 0191 371 2727.

Local bus services are readily accessible, and comprehensive travel information can be downloaded here. Whether you're continuing your journey by train to nearby cities such as Newcastle or Leeds, or venturing further afield to Manchester Piccadilly or London Kings Cross, the connections are extensive. If your travels include international flights, you can reach Durham Tees Valley or Newcastle airports with ease via combined train and bus or metro routes.

Facilities and Amenities

Newcastle Train Station is well-equipped to make your travel experience as smooth as possible. The ticket office opens as early as 6 AM on weekdays, providing ample time for travelers to plan ahead. Alternatively, convenient ticket machines are scattered throughout the station, and they cater well to those with accessibility needs. For comfort, the station offers waiting rooms and seating areas, both of which are open throughout the operating hours. If you require any assistance, staff are on hand from the early hours until midnight.

The station is accessibility friendly with step-free access available to several platforms, assisted by both lifts and ramps when necessary. Do note, however, that while the station is widely accessible, some platforms accessed via steep bridges may require assistance. The luxurious 1st Class Lounge offers an elevated waiting experience and is a delightful option for premium ticket holders.

Transport Connections

Getting in and out of Newcastle is a breeze, thanks to the extensive transport options available at the station. Taxis are available 24/7, and rail replacement services conveniently depart from the station's front. The local Tyne & Wear Metro system provides seamless connections to the Newcastle airport and beyond, easily accessible from adjacent platforms. For more information on bus schedules and routes, the station offers printable guides, ensuring you're well-equipped for onward travel.
